That screen will show the first time NRSM runs. You will get the same output if you issue
Code: [Select]
cat /proc/mdstatfrom the command line.

Once you accept that screen (be sure your raid is syncronized and clean before you do), if anything changes and raid goes out of sync or a disk goes down, NRSM will report an error in the raid status of that server.

For more information on SME raid see the following:
